Peningkatan Daya Ingat dan Hasil Belajar Siswa dengan Mind Mapping Method pada Materi Listrik Dinamis Annisa, Rizki; Subali, Bambang; Heryanto, Wawan Prasetyo
Jurnal Pendidikan (Teori dan Praktik) Vol 3, No 1 (2018): Volume 3, Nomor 1, April 2018

Abstract

Metode mind mapping dalam penelitian ini bertujuan untuk meningkatkan daya ingat, hasil belajar, dan perhatian siswa mata pelajaran fisika materi listrik dinamis kelas IX MTs Al Futuhiyyah Bumirejo, Wonosobo. Sampel dalam penelitian ini adalah kelas IX Al Haitsam (A) berjumlah 25 siswa dengan  nilai mata pelajaran fisika rata-rata di bawah KKM. Penelitian ini menggunakan Penelitian Tindakan Kelas (PTK) sebanyak 2 siklus. Masing-masing siklus terdiri dari tahap perencanaan, pelaksanaan, pengamatan, dan refleksi yang mengadopsi model Kurt Lewin. Daya ingat siswa dapat diketahui dengan membuat mind mapping, hasil belajar diperoleh dengan tes uraian, dan perhatian belajar didapatkan dari observasi. Hasil penelitian menunjukan bahwa: 1) penggunaan metode mind mapping dapat meningkatkan daya ingat siswa kelas IX MTs Al Futuhiyyah dari 38% menjadi 68%, 2) penggunaan metode mind mapping dapat meningkatkan hasil belajar siswa kelas IX MTs Al Futuhiyyah dengan siswa yang mecapai KKM dari 36% menjadi 56%, 3) penggunaan metode mind mapping dapat memfokuskan perhatian dalam proses belajar siswa kelas IX MTs Al Futuhiyyah dengan persentase siswa 72%. AbstractMind Mapping method in this research purposed to improve memory, learning result, and students’ attention to study physics with dynamic electricity subject 9th grade student of MTs Al Futuhiyyah Bumirejo, Wonosobo. Sample in this research are 9th grade of Al Haitsam (A) amount 25 students with physics subject score under KKM. The research using Action Research (PTK) as much as two Cycles. Each cycle based on planning step, acting, observing, and reflecting it refers to Kurt Lewin model. The students’ memory are able to be known by mind mapping, The study result are obtained by description test, and The study attention are obtained from observation. The result of the study indicated that: 1) the use of mind mapping method could improve memory of the 9th grade student MTs Al Futuhiyyah from 38% became 68%, 2) the use of mind mapping method could improve the result learning of 9th grade student of MTs Al Futuhiyyah. It can be seen from the student who surpassed KKM from 36% became 56%, 3) the use of mind mapping method is appropriate to get students attention in teaching and learning process with percentage 72% .
Analysis of the Try Out Problem for the National Examination of Natural Sciences Physics Type HOTS Heryanto, Wawan Prasetyo; Supriyadi, Supriyadi; Darsono, Teguh
Physics Communication Vol 4, No 2 (2020): August 2020

Abstract

This research's aim is to know about HOTS questions of Physics in try out of National Examination and HOTS's students of Junior High School Muhammadiyah 1 Wonosobo. The research type was descriptive research, and the research used analysis technique. This technique is done by analyze question documents and students' answer sheet of trying out of Physics National Examination HOTS students of Muhammadiyah 1 Wonosobo junior high school. The subjects in this study were students of class IX Muhammadiyah 1 Wonosobo junior high school in the academic year 2019/2020 with 126 students. The data obtained in the form of a percentage of HOTS type questions and the percentage of students absorption of the results of working out the try out problem. Based on the analysis of the data that has been done, obtained by the category of HOTS is 23.5%, namely in the C4 aspects and the absorption of students by 28.5% with the category is not good. Therefore, it can be concluded that type of HOTS questions in the tryout of Physics National Examination has poor distribution.
